CUMBERLAND COUNTY, Pa.–Two men are facing federal drug trafficking charges after prosecutors say they  were caught with methamphetamine in Cumberland County in July.

Delfin Ricardo-Hechevvarria, 55, of Albany, New York, and Jorge Gonzalez-Gonzalez, 59, of Reading, are charged with possessing and conspiring to possess and distribute methamphetamine, according to United States Attorney Peter Smith,

Both men were arrested on July 3 during a traffic stop in Cumberland County when a search of their vehicle  led to the seizure of methamphetamine, prosecutors said.

The investigation was conducted by the Drug Enforcement Administration in Harrisburg, the Pennsylvania State Police, and the Cumberland County District Attorney’s Office.
